Experimental Modal Analysis testing - a powerful tool for identifying the in-service condition of bridge structures

The Experimental Modal Analysis (EMA) testing technique provides a great deal more information about the in-service condition of a bridge under test than is possible from the more traditional forms of static testing through identification of the modal properties (natural frequencies, mode shapes and damping levels) of the bridge concerned. This information is of immense value to the "tuning" of Finite Element Method (FEM) based models which can then be used with confidence for assessing bridge load carrying capacity and response to seismic and other dynamic load inputs. This paper outlines some of the key features of the technique highlighting results obtained from its application to the field testing of several bridges by the University of Melbourne structural engineering research team.
